What the average in-home child care cost looks like varies based on factors like how many children you have, your location, and how experienced the caregiver is. If you want overnight child care, that can also impact how much you’ll spend. However, as of January, 2026, the average in-home child care rate per hour on Care.com is $19.30 for in-home child care providers near you in Tucson, AZ.
